Project Description: The applicant proposes to install one 20 inch by 10 inch diameter gravel-packed well at the existing Old Neck Road Well Field. The well would be approximately 500 feet deep and draw water from the Magothy Aquifer. It would be equipped with an electrically-driven deep well turbine pump rated at a capacity of 1300 gpm. |

Project Description: The applicant proposes to: subdivide a 10.635 acre parcel into 15 residential lots with a dwelling and associated amenities on each and internal roadways; replace 760 feet of bulkhead within 18" and replace/expand landward wood walk and placement of approximately 420 cubic yards of clean upland fill as backfill; remove existing footbridge on north side of pond and reconstruct on south side of pond; reconstruct existing dam and replace footbridge; remove existing structures including asphalt drive and revegetate; install 3' x 15' ramp, 6' x 15' float and four anchor piles. The property is located at e/s/o Oak Neck Lane approximately 1,152 feet s/o Montauk Highway, SCTM#0500-475-02-12.1 & 12.3, West Islip, Islip Town, Suffolk County, Trues Creek, Freshwater Wetland# BW-7. |
